Is Mondaine made in Switzerland?

Swiss Made for everyone. M-WATCH Mondaine was first introduced in 1983 by Mondaine Watch Ltd., Zurich/Switzerland (est. 1951) as a value-priced, fashion watch line, offering exceptional Swiss design and manufacture for an international mass market.

  • Why are watches called quartz?

    Quartz, made up of silica and oxygen, is one of the most common minerals on Earth. Quartz crystals maintain a precise frequency standard, which helps to regulate the movement of a watch or clock, thus making the timepieces very accurate. …

    Where are Seiko clocks made?

    Currently watch movements are made in Shizukuishi, Iwate (SII Morioka Seiko Instruments), Ninohe, Iwate (SII Ninohe Tokei Kogyo), Shiojiri, Nagano (Seiko Epson) and their subsidiaries in China, Malaysia and Singapore. The fully integrated in-house production system is still practiced for luxury watches in Japan.

    What kind of case does a Swiss railway clock have?

    Its brushed matte aluminum case provides an understated backdrop for the legendary Swiss railway clock dial with its distinctive black hour and minute hands and red seconds hand.
